Rape and Murder Case in Karnataka: 20-year-old BA student Partially Burnt Body Found

A 20 -year -old student’s partially burnt body found two days after the disappearance in Chitradurg district of Karnataka. Varshita, a second-year BA student at the First Grade College of the Government’s Women, left her hostel on 14 August and did not return.

His parents had come to file a missing complaint and informed about his death, causing them to be in shock and grief. Police suspect that Varshita was raped and murdered, and his body set on fire to destroy the evidence.

A case of murder registered at the Rural Police Station, and a large-scale investigation is going on for the accused. When the investigation continued, Disp Dikar and Pai Mudu Raj visited the hospital. Officers are waiting for the post-mortem report.
